READING the headlines about the recent vote for $109 billion for the war in Iraq and Katrina, I am reminded of a story Ma Decker told me many years ago. Ma came out to the west by train during the close of the Indian wars. When she was a young girl, she told me, a mendicant priest came to the door with a long tale about the missions to save the "poor heathen."

Her mother patiently listened to his tale, then went and got her purse. "Here's a dime for the poor heathen," she said, "and a dollar to see that he gets it."

Somehow, I have the feeling that times have not changed. Congress has voted the dollar for the war, hoping that Katrina will see the dime. I wouldn't count on it.
